Should hip pain be assessed by a doctor when it is initially felt?

When feeling pain in one's hip, most people take a wait and see approach, in the hope they will feel better and the pain will go away. If hip pain does not go away and it is persistent, one must see a doctor to assess their hip pain.

Do bikes help hip pain?

Bikes can help hip pain if the joints aren't under constant pressure. The key terrain for moderating hip pain would be to ride a bike on a level non-inclining road. By keeping up with riding, the hip pain may get better and less obtrusive.

Dealing With Hip And Joint Pain?

Almost everyone gets mild hip or your joint pain from time to time. Sometimes, the joint pain is mild, while other times the joint pain is severe. It is important to stay on top of your hip joint pain, and ensure that you are able to still cope with the pain. If your hip joint pain ever passes to the point where it is unmanageable, you should talk to your doctor about what the best options are for you with pain. Many people take a simple, over-the-counter medication to deal with hip pain. If you're dealing with hip pain after, say, a long walk in the park, then hip pain can be easily dealt with by taking a simple painkiller. If you have any questions about painkiller, such as which ones are safe and which ones you should use, you should always talk to your doctor about it. If you are finding that your hip and your joint pain is beginning to get unmanageable, you should talk to a doctor. They will be the best people for advice on how to properly manage the pain, and may even offer some unique tips and tricks to assist you with living with any of the pain that you may experience. If you are unsure about what is severe hip pain and what is mild hip pain, it still likely that a trip to the doctor will be needed. Dealing with hip pain can be frustrating, but remember that you aren't alone. There are many people that suffer from hip and joint pain each year. Sometimes, a simple painkiller may manage the pain. Other times, more drastic measures are needed. If you feel like you are experiencing hip and joint pain that is becoming unmanageable, you should speak to your doctor. They will be able to give you solid, sound medical advice and offer you ideas as to what will work for you.
